thirde of the
kinges. The Vulgate designates 1 and 2 Samuel as "1 and 2
Kings," 1 and 2 Kings as "3 and 4 Kings."We follow the titles used in
the KJV because it is based on the Hebrew.

Iob . . .
dongehyll. Cf. Job. 2.8. KJV has "among the ashes."
David Daniell noted in a letter that "dunghill" comes from the
Septuagint and the Vulgate, but "ashes" is found in Luther and
Geneva [private correspondence].
